Skip to content

Commit eca7248

Browse files
committed
fix for junit being included in runtime scope
1 parent 562e053 commit eca7248

40 files changed

Lines changed: 113 additions & 112 deletions

File tree

README.md

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-42,7 +42,7 @@ following sample:
4242
<dependency>
4343
<groupId>com.vladsch.flexmark</groupId>
4444
<artifactId>flexmark-all</artifactId>
45-
<version>0.22.20</version>
45+
<version>0.22.22</version>
4646
</dependency>
4747
```
4848

@@ -85,7 +85,7 @@ public class BasicSample {
8585
#### Building via Gradle
8686

8787
```shell
88-
compile 'com.vladsch.flexmark:flexmark-all:0.22.20'
88+
compile 'com.vladsch.flexmark:flexmark-all:0.22.22'
8989
```
9090

9191
#### Building with Android Studio

VERSION.md

Lines changed: 7 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-6,6 +6,7 @@ flexmark-java
66
[TOC]: # " "
77

88
- [To Do](#to-do)
9+
- [0.22.22](#02222)
910
- [0.22.20](#02220)
1011
- [0.22.18](#02218)
1112
- [0.22.16](#02216)
@@ -165,6 +166,12 @@ flexmark-java
165166

166167
&nbsp;</details>
167168

169+
0.22.22
170+
-------
171+
172+
* Fix: remove `flexmark-ext-spec-example` module from `flexmark-all` dependencies because it
173+
would cause junit to be included in runtime scope.
174+
168175
0.22.20
169176
-------
170177

flexmark-all/pom.xml

Lines changed: 32 additions & 37 deletions
Original file line numberDiff line numberDiff line change
@@ -7,7 +7,7 @@
77
<parent>
88
<groupId>com.vladsch.flexmark</groupId>
99
<artifactId>flexmark-java</artifactId>
10-
<version>0.22.20</version>
10+
<version>0.22.22</version>
1111
</parent>
1212

1313
<artifactId>flexmark-all</artifactId>
@@ -21,162 +21,157 @@
2121
<dependency>
2222
<groupId>com.vladsch.flexmark</groupId>
2323
<artifactId>flexmark</artifactId>
24-
<version>0.22.20</version>
24+
<version>0.22.22</version>
2525
</dependency>
2626
<dependency>
2727
<groupId>com.vladsch.flexmark</groupId>
2828
<artifactId>flexmark-ext-abbreviation</artifactId>
29-
<version>0.22.20</version>
29+
<version>0.22.22</version>
3030
</dependency>
3131
<dependency>
3232
<groupId>com.vladsch.flexmark</groupId>
3333
<artifactId>flexmark-ext-anchorlink</artifactId>
34-
<version>0.22.20</version>
34+
<version>0.22.22</version>
3535
</dependency>
3636
<dependency>
3737
<groupId>com.vladsch.flexmark</groupId>
3838
<artifactId>flexmark-ext-aside</artifactId>
39-
<version>0.22.20</version>
39+
<version>0.22.22</version>
4040
</dependency>
4141
<dependency>
4242
<groupId>com.vladsch.flexmark</groupId>
4343
<artifactId>flexmark-ext-autolink</artifactId>
44-
<version>0.22.20</version>
44+
<version>0.22.22</version>
4545
</dependency>
4646
<dependency>
4747
<groupId>com.vladsch.flexmark</groupId>
4848
<artifactId>flexmark-ext-definition</artifactId>
49-
<version>0.22.20</version>
49+
<version>0.22.22</version>
5050
</dependency>
5151
<dependency>
5252
<groupId>com.vladsch.flexmark</groupId>
5353
<artifactId>flexmark-ext-emoji</artifactId>
54-
<version>0.22.20</version>
54+
<version>0.22.22</version>
5555
</dependency>
5656
<dependency>
5757
<groupId>com.vladsch.flexmark</groupId>
5858
<artifactId>flexmark-ext-escaped-character</artifactId>
59-
<version>0.22.20</version>
59+
<version>0.22.22</version>
6060
</dependency>
6161
<dependency>
6262
<groupId>com.vladsch.flexmark</groupId>
6363
<artifactId>flexmark-ext-footnotes</artifactId>
64-
<version>0.22.20</version>
64+
<version>0.22.22</version>
6565
</dependency>
6666
<dependency>
6767
<groupId>com.vladsch.flexmark</groupId>
6868
<artifactId>flexmark-ext-gfm-issues</artifactId>
69-
<version>0.22.20</version>
69+
<version>0.22.22</version>
7070
</dependency>
7171
<dependency>
7272
<groupId>com.vladsch.flexmark</groupId>
7373
<artifactId>flexmark-ext-gfm-strikethrough</artifactId>
74-
<version>0.22.20</version>
74+
<version>0.22.22</version>
7575
</dependency>
7676
<dependency>
7777
<groupId>com.vladsch.flexmark</groupId>
7878
<artifactId>flexmark-ext-gfm-tables</artifactId>
79-
<version>0.22.20</version>
79+
<version>0.22.22</version>
8080
</dependency>
8181
<dependency>
8282
<groupId>com.vladsch.flexmark</groupId>
8383
<artifactId>flexmark-ext-gfm-tasklist</artifactId>
84-
<version>0.22.20</version>
84+
<version>0.22.22</version>
8585
</dependency>
8686
<dependency>
8787
<groupId>com.vladsch.flexmark</groupId>
8888
<artifactId>flexmark-ext-gfm-users</artifactId>
89-
<version>0.22.20</version>
89+
<version>0.22.22</version>
9090
</dependency>
9191
<dependency>
9292
<groupId>com.vladsch.flexmark</groupId>
9393
<artifactId>flexmark-ext-jekyll-front-matter</artifactId>
94-
<version>0.22.20</version>
94+
<version>0.22.22</version>
9595
</dependency>
9696
<dependency>
9797
<groupId>com.vladsch.flexmark</groupId>
9898
<artifactId>flexmark-ext-jekyll-tag</artifactId>
99-
<version>0.22.20</version>
99+
<version>0.22.22</version>
100100
</dependency>
101101
<dependency>
102102
<groupId>com.vladsch.flexmark</groupId>
103103
<artifactId>flexmark-ext-ins</artifactId>
104-
<version>0.22.20</version>
104+
<version>0.22.22</version>
105105
</dependency>
106106
<dependency>
107107
<groupId>com.vladsch.flexmark</groupId>
108108
<artifactId>flexmark-ext-xwiki-macros</artifactId>
109-
<version>0.22.20</version>
110-
</dependency>
111-
<dependency>
112-
<groupId>com.vladsch.flexmark</groupId>
113-
<artifactId>flexmark-ext-spec-example</artifactId>
114-
<version>0.22.20</version>
109+
<version>0.22.22</version>
115110
</dependency>
116111
<dependency>
117112
<groupId>com.vladsch.flexmark</groupId>
118113
<artifactId>flexmark-ext-superscript</artifactId>
119-
<version>0.22.20</version>
114+
<version>0.22.22</version>
120115
</dependency>
121116
<dependency>
122117
<groupId>com.vladsch.flexmark</groupId>
123118
<artifactId>flexmark-ext-tables</artifactId>
124-
<version>0.22.20</version>
119+
<version>0.22.22</version>
125120
</dependency>
126121
<dependency>
127122
<groupId>com.vladsch.flexmark</groupId>
128123
<artifactId>flexmark-ext-toc</artifactId>
129-
<version>0.22.20</version>
124+
<version>0.22.22</version>
130125
</dependency>
131126
<dependency>
132127
<groupId>com.vladsch.flexmark</groupId>
133128
<artifactId>flexmark-ext-typographic</artifactId>
134-
<version>0.22.20</version>
129+
<version>0.22.22</version>
135130
</dependency>
136131
<dependency>
137132
<groupId>com.vladsch.flexmark</groupId>
138133
<artifactId>flexmark-ext-wikilink</artifactId>
139-
<version>0.22.20</version>
134+
<version>0.22.22</version>
140135
</dependency>
141136
<dependency>
142137
<groupId>com.vladsch.flexmark</groupId>
143138
<artifactId>flexmark-ext-yaml-front-matter</artifactId>
144-
<version>0.22.20</version>
139+
<version>0.22.22</version>
145140
</dependency>
146141
<dependency>
147142
<groupId>com.vladsch.flexmark</groupId>
148143
<artifactId>flexmark-formatter</artifactId>
149-
<version>0.22.20</version>
144+
<version>0.22.22</version>
150145
</dependency>
151146
<dependency>
152147
<groupId>com.vladsch.flexmark</groupId>
153148
<artifactId>flexmark-html-parser</artifactId>
154-
<version>0.22.20</version>
149+
<version>0.22.22</version>
155150
</dependency>
156151
<dependency>
157152
<groupId>com.vladsch.flexmark</groupId>
158153
<artifactId>flexmark-jira-converter</artifactId>
159-
<version>0.22.20</version>
154+
<version>0.22.22</version>
160155
</dependency>
161156
<dependency>
162157
<groupId>com.vladsch.flexmark</groupId>
163158
<artifactId>flexmark-pdf-converter</artifactId>
164-
<version>0.22.20</version>
159+
<version>0.22.22</version>
165160
</dependency>
166161
<dependency>
167162
<groupId>com.vladsch.flexmark</groupId>
168163
<artifactId>flexmark-profile-pegdown</artifactId>
169-
<version>0.22.20</version>
164+
<version>0.22.22</version>
170165
</dependency>
171166
<dependency>
172167
<groupId>com.vladsch.flexmark</groupId>
173168
<artifactId>flexmark-util</artifactId>
174-
<version>0.22.20</version>
169+
<version>0.22.22</version>
175170
</dependency>
176171
<dependency>
177172
<groupId>com.vladsch.flexmark</groupId>
178173
<artifactId>flexmark-youtrack-converter</artifactId>
179-
<version>0.22.20</version>
174+
<version>0.22.22</version>
180175
</dependency>
181176
</dependencies>
182177

flexmark-all/src/assembly/bin.xml

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-29,7 +29,6 @@
2929
<include>com.vladsch.flexmark:flexmark-ext-jekyll-tag</include>
3030
<include>com.vladsch.flexmark:flexmark-ext-ins</include>
3131
<include>com.vladsch.flexmark:flexmark-ext-xwiki-macros</include>
32-
<include>com.vladsch.flexmark:flexmark-ext-spec-example</include>
3332
<include>com.vladsch.flexmark:flexmark-ext-superscript</include>
3433
<include>com.vladsch.flexmark:flexmark-ext-tables</include>
3534
<include>com.vladsch.flexmark:flexmark-ext-toc</include>

flexmark-ext-abbreviation/pom.xml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-4,7 +4,7 @@
44
<parent>
55
<groupId>com.vladsch.flexmark</groupId>
66
<artifactId>flexmark-java</artifactId>
7-
<version>0.22.20</version>
7+
<version>0.22.22</version>
88
</parent>
99

1010
<artifactId>flexmark-ext-abbreviation</artifactId>

flexmark-ext-anchorlink/pom.xml

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-4,7 +4,7 @@
44
<parent>
55
<groupId>com.vladsch.flexmark</groupId>
66
<artifactId>flexmark-java</artifactId>
7-
<version>0.22.20</version>
7+
<version>0.22.22</version>
88
</parent>
99

1010
<artifactId>flexmark-ext-anchorlink</artifactId>
@@ -28,7 +28,7 @@
2828
<dependency>
2929
<groupId>com.vladsch.flexmark</groupId>
3030
<artifactId>flexmark-jira-converter</artifactId>
31-
<version>0.22.20</version>
31+
<version>0.22.22</version>
3232
<scope>test</scope>
3333
</dependency>
3434
<dependency>

flexmark-ext-aside/pom.xml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-4,7 +4,7 @@
44
<parent>
55
<groupId>com.vladsch.flexmark</groupId>
66
<artifactId>flexmark-java</artifactId>
7-
<version>0.22.20</version>
7+
<version>0.22.22</version>
88
</parent>
99

1010
<artifactId>flexmark-ext-aside</artifactId>

flexmark-ext-autolink/pom.xml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-4,7 +4,7 @@
44
<parent>
55
<groupId>com.vladsch.flexmark</groupId>
66
<artifactId>flexmark-java</artifactId>
7-
<version>0.22.20</version>
7+
<version>0.22.22</version>
88
</parent>
99

1010
<artifactId>flexmark-ext-autolink</artifactId>

flexmark-ext-definition/pom.xml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-4,7 +4,7 @@
44
<parent>
55
<groupId>com.vladsch.flexmark</groupId>
66
<artifactId>flexmark-java</artifactId>
7-
<version>0.22.20</version>
7+
<version>0.22.22</version>
88
</parent>
99

1010
<artifactId>flexmark-ext-definition</artifactId>

flexmark-ext-emoji/pom.xml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-4,7 +4,7 @@
44
<parent>
55
<groupId>com.vladsch.flexmark</groupId>
66
<artifactId>flexmark-java</artifactId>
7-
<version>0.22.20</version>
7+
<version>0.22.22</version>
88
</parent>
99

1010
<artifactId>flexmark-ext-emoji</artifactId>

0 commit comments

Comments
 (0)